Can I withdraw the winnings from the free spins bonus right away?

Winning from free spins usually comes with certain conditions before you can withdraw them. Most casinos require you to meet a wagering requirement, which means you need to bet the amount you won a specific number of times before it becomes withdrawable. For example, if you win $50 from free spins and the wagering requirement is 30x, you must place bets totaling $1,500 before you can cash out. Also, some bonuses may have a maximum withdrawal limit on winnings from free spins, and not all games contribute equally to the wagering. Slots often count 100%, while table games might count less or not at all. Always check the terms and conditions of the bonus before playing. Some casinos also restrict withdrawals until you’ve verified your account or completed a deposit. It’s best to read the fine print carefully to avoid surprises later.
